$1 Million Haskell Invitational to be run at Monmouth Park Sunday

The 45th running of the Grade 1 $1 million Haskell Invitational Stakes will be at Monmouth Park on Sunday.

by Lynne Snierson

One million dollars. That's the purse that some of the top three-year-old horses in the country will be vying for when they line up in the starting gate for the Haskell Invitational Stakes at Monmouth Park on Sunday, July 29.

There will also be bragging rights at stake. The Haskell is a Grade 1 race, meaning that it is ranked in the elite class of races run and the winner will take his place among the best horses in training and deserve strong consideration when the discussion is held about year-end championships. The winner will also stand among some of the sport's immortals who have won the Haskell's 44 previous runnings.

Dullahan and Paynter, who competed in this year's Triple Crown races and finished third in the Kentucky Derby and second in the Belmont Stakes, respectively, are headed to Monmouth Park for the Haskell and have been training brilliantly in preparation. They'll meet many other accomplished runners in the starting gate.

In addition to the Grade 1 $1 million Haskell, the races that day include six supporting stakes races offering another $800,000 in purse money and one is a Grade 2 race and two more carry a Grade 3. Haskell Day, complete with 14 outstanding races, is a day not to be missed.
